Загрузка...

Java Polymorphism Explained: Method Overloading & Overriding

Master the final pillar of OOP! In this detailed guide, we explain Polymorphism in Java using simple analogies, clear diagrams, and step-by-step code. Whether you're an engineering student prepping for a viva or a beginner building your first app, this video covers everything you need to know about Static and Dynamic Polymorphism.

What's Inside:
✅ Greek roots of Polymorphism (Poly + Morphs)
✅ The "Person" Analogy (Context-based behavior)
✅ Method Overloading vs. Method Overriding
✅ Upcasting & Dynamic Method Dispatch
✅ Why use Polymorphism? (Extensibility & Clean Code)
✅ Common Interview & Exam Questions

#Java #Polymorphism #OOP #JavaProgramming #CodingForBeginners #ComputerScience #JavaTutorial #EngineeringExams

Видео Java Polymorphism Explained: Method Overloading & Overriding канала AYER VERSE
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ять